首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Selenium python选择下拉框选项。ng选择组合框XPath

使用Selenium Python选择下拉框选项的方法是通过XPath来定位下拉框元素,并使用相关方法进行选项的选择。

首先,需要导入Selenium库和相关模块:

代码语言:txt
复制
from selenium import webdriver
from selenium.webdriver.support.ui import Select

接下来,创建一个WebDriver实例:

代码语言:txt
复制
driver = webdriver.Chrome()

然后,使用XPath定位下拉框元素:

代码语言:txt
复制
dropdown = driver.find_element_by_xpath("XPath")

其中,"XPath"需要替换为实际的XPath表达式,用于定位下拉框元素。

接着,创建一个Select对象,用于操作下拉框选项:

代码语言:txt
复制
select = Select(dropdown)

可以使用select对象的方法来选择下拉框选项,比如根据选项的可见文本选择:

代码语言:txt
复制
select.select_by_visible_text("选项文本")

其中,"选项文本"需要替换为实际的下拉框选项文本。

或者根据选项的值选择:

代码语言:txt
复制
select.select_by_value("选项值")

其中,"选项值"需要替换为实际的下拉框选项值。

另外,还可以根据选项的索引选择:

代码语言:txt
复制
select.select_by_index(2)

其中,索引从0开始,表示选择第3个选项。

最后,记得关闭WebDriver实例:

代码语言:txt
复制
driver.quit()

关于ng选择组合框XPath的具体解释,需要提供更详细的上下文信息,以便能够给出准确的XPath表达式。XPath是一种用于在XML文档中定位元素的语言,通过使用不同的属性和关系来定位元素。根据具体的HTML结构和ng选择组合框的特点,可以使用不同的XPath表达式来定位该元素。

对于XPath的学习和使用,可以参考腾讯云的开发者文档中的相关内容:XPath语法

希望以上信息对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券